I'm looking at replacing the rim for my back tire on Tiki and I'm a bit lost. Is there a difference between a tireless rim and and a regular rim other than price and the type of brake I'm using?

Any of those would do though I'm not a fan of chrome rims. Much easier to clean a painted rim.

You do not want "tubeless" rims. The one piece tubeless rims SIP (and others) sell make it very difficult to mount tires. I bought a set once and have been throwing them away as the tires wear out.

Put a shot of "Slime" tire sealant into your tubes and you'll get a nice slow leak if you get a puncture -- rather than the usual blow-out.
